English: Creating and Using Normalized Difference Vegetation Index (NDVI) from Satellite Imagery

Part 4: MODIS NDVI Anomalies

An overview of MODIS NDVI anomaly mapping, a demonstration of the GIMMS MODIS Agricultural Monitoring System, and how to create a MODIS NDVI anomaly map.

You can access all training materials from this webinar series on the training webpage: https://appliedsciences.nasa.gov/join-mission/training/english/arset-creating-and-using-normalized-difference-vegetation-index-ndvi

This training was created by NASA's Applied Remote Sensing Training Program (ARSET). ARSET is a part of NASA's Applied Science's Capacity Building Program. Learn more about ARSET: https://appliedsciences.nasa.gov/what-we-do/capacity-building/arset
